Armenian ambassador meets White House Faith Office head

1 minute read

Armenian Ambassador to the United States Narek Mkrtchyan held a meeting with Paula White-Cain, head of the White House Faith Office and U.S. President Donald Trump’s longtime spiritual advisor and pastor. 

According to an embassy readout, during the meeting, the sides emphasized the importance of faith and spiritual values, highlighting their role in strengthening peace and solidarity.

The ambassador thanked the Faith Office for the cooperation established with the embassy, as well as for the support provided to Christian initiatives.

They also exchanged views on issues of mutual interest and discussed possibilities for developing cooperation between Armenia and the United States in various areas.
